What Key Features Differentiate the Best Long Reach Kitchen Faucets?
The key features that differentiate the best long reach kitchen faucets include:
- Spout Height: The spout height is crucial for providing ample clearance for washing large pots and pans. A higher spout allows for more versatility in the kitchen and makes it easier to fill tall vessels without spilling.
- Reach Length: The reach length refers to how far the faucet extends from its base, which is essential for accessing various areas of the sink without needing to move the faucet itself. A longer reach means you can easily fill containers placed in different positions around the sink.
- Swivel Capability: Many of the best long reach kitchen faucets come with swivel features, allowing the spout to rotate a full 360 degrees. This flexibility increases convenience by enabling users to direct water flow exactly where it’s needed, whether for rinsing dishes or cleaning the sink.
- Spray Options: Faucets that offer multiple spray settings enhance functionality by allowing users to switch between a strong spray for rinsing and a gentle stream for filling pots. This versatility can save time and effort during food preparation and cleaning tasks.
- Material Quality: The best long reach kitchen faucets are typically made from high-quality materials like brass or stainless steel, ensuring durability and resistance to corrosion. A well-constructed faucet not only lasts longer but also maintains its aesthetic appeal over time.
- Installation Type: The installation type, whether it be a pull-down, pull-out, or traditional design, can greatly affect usability. Pull-down and pull-out faucets offer increased reach and flexibility, making them a popular choice in modern kitchens.
- Water Flow Rate: The water flow rate, measured in gallons per minute (GPM), is important for efficiency. Faucets with a higher flow rate allow for quicker filling of pots and pans but should also maintain a balance with water conservation standards.
- Ease of Use: Features like a single handle design or touchless operation increase ease of use, especially when hands are wet or messy. Ergonomically designed handles provide a comfortable grip, making it easier to control water flow and temperature.

How Do You Properly Install and Maintain a Long Reach Kitchen Faucet?
To properly install and maintain a long reach kitchen faucet, follow these essential steps:
- Installation Preparation: Ensure you have all necessary tools and materials ready, including a basin wrench, plumber’s tape, and the faucet installation manual. Before starting, turn off the water supply and disconnect the old faucet to make room for the new long reach model.
- Mounting the Faucet: Position the long reach faucet over the sink hole and secure it using the mounting hardware provided. It’s important to tighten the nuts evenly to avoid damaging the sink or the faucet.
- Connecting Water Supply Lines: Attach the hot and cold water supply lines to the corresponding connections on the faucet. Use plumber’s tape on the threads to ensure a watertight seal and check for any leaks after connecting.
- Testing the Faucet: Once installed, turn the water supply back on and test the faucet for both hot and cold water. Check for proper function and any leaks at the connections, tightening as necessary.
- Regular Cleaning: To maintain your long reach kitchen faucet, clean it regularly with a soft cloth and mild soap to prevent buildup of mineral deposits and stains.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can scratch the finish.
- Inspecting and Replacing Parts: Periodically inspect the faucet for wear and tear, including the aerator and cartridges. Replacing these parts as needed can prevent leaks and ensure optimal water flow.
